==A Success from the Start==  
==A Success from the Start==  
Launched at the 1975 Paris Salon, the '''[[Yamaha]] XT500''' was the first Japanese off-road bike with a big single engine.It starred a revolution and was such a success from the start that it enabled the development of desert racing as we know it today. For starters, it won the Abidjan-Nice rally, then, ridden by [[Cyril Neveu]], the first two [[Paris-Dakar]] rallies in 1979 and 1980, Simple and sturdy, it was the ideal bike to ride to the ends of the Earth or use every day. and it didn't let down the amateur adventurers who chose it.
